A Guide to Writing Effective Article Headlines: Bring Attention to Your Content
The headline is the gateway to your article, and it plays a crucial role in attracting readers. Whether you’re a journalist, a blogger, or a content writer, an attention-grabbing headline is essential to ensure that your piece stands out in the sea of online content. In this guide, we’ll explore the art of writing effective headlines and provide valuable tips to help you optimize your headlines to capture the attention of your target audience.
1. Understand Your Audience:
Before diving into crafting headlines, it’s crucial to know your audience. Determine what interests them, their pain points, and what questions they might have. This understanding will enable you to tailor your headlines to appeal directly to their needs and interests, increasing the chances of attracting their attention.
2. Keep It Clear and Concise:
Clarity is key when it comes to headlines. A reader should be able to understand the essence of your article just by reading the headline. Keep it simple, straightforward, and avoid using jargon or convoluted language. While it’s essential to grab attention, don’t sacrifice clarity for the sake of being flashy.
3. Incorporate Action Words:
Action words evoke a sense of excitement and urgency. Using strong verbs in your headlines will make them more engaging and dynamic. Instead of saying “Tips for Better Writing,” use action verbs like “Master the Art of Writing with These Proven Tips.” This creates a more compelling and actionable headline that encourages readers to click.
4. Create Curiosity:
Curiosity is a powerful motivator. An effective way to intrigue readers is by creating a headline that piques their interest. Pose a question or promise a solution, deliberately leaving out the answer in the headline. For instance, instead of “How to Improve Your Writing,” try “Discover the Simple Secret to Transforming Your Writing Skills.”
5. Appeal to Emotion:
Emotions play a significant role in decision-making, and headlines that tap into readers’ emotions are more likely to grab attention. Consider how your content can connect with readers on an emotional level and reflect that in your headlines. For example, “Unleash Your Creativity: Overcome Writer’s Block Once and for All.”
6. Use Numbers and Lists:
Numbers and lists make headlines more tangible and specific. They provide readers with a clear idea of what to expect from your article. Utilize numbers to emphasize the amount of information or steps your article provides. For instance, “10 Simple Steps to Enhance Your Writing Style.”
7. Optimize for SEO:
Search engine optimization (SEO) is crucial for online visibility. Incorporate relevant keywords naturally in your headlines to increase the likelihood of your article appearing in search results. However, remember not to sacrifice clarity or compromise the headline’s effectiveness to fit in keywords.
8. Test and Refine:
Headline creation is an iterative process. Don’t be afraid to experiment with different headline variations to find what works best for your audience. Analyze the performance of your headlines using analytics tools to identify trends and make data-driven decisions for future optimizations.
FAQs:
1. Are clickbait headlines effective?
Clickbait headlines, although they may attract initial attention, often result in high bounce rates and a negative impact on your brand reputation. It’s best to focus on writing genuine, informative headlines that accurately represent your content.
2. How long should a headline be?
Ideally, a headline should be around 6-8 words or 60-80 characters. However, if you need to convey more information, ensure the most critical keywords appear within the first 70 characters, as search engines often truncate headlines after this point.
3. Can I reuse headlines?
While it’s possible to reuse headlines, it’s recommended to customize them for each platform or article. Different audiences and contexts may require slight modifications to maintain relevance and effectiveness.
